Item 7.01. Regulation FD Disclosure.
Duke Energy Corporation (“Duke Energy”) is one of many companies providing essential services during this national emergency related to the COVID-19 pandemic. We have implemented a comprehensive set of actions to help our customers, communities, and employees, and will continue to closely monitor developments and adjust as needed to ensure reliable service while protecting the safety and health of our workforce. In addition to measures to protect our workforce and critical operations, Duke Energy is actively managing the materials, supplies, and contract services for our generation, transmission, distribution, and customer services functions. Duke Energy currently has no issues of significance in the supply chain for our core electric and gas utilities businesses. Furthermore, at this time there are no significant supply chain issues in our Commercial Renewables business, and all of our solar and wind generation projects with forecasted significant contributions to 2020 earnings are currently expected to reach commercial operation in 2020. We will continue to closely manage and monitor developments in our supply chain.
Duke Energy plans to announce its first quarter 2020 financial results on Tuesday, May 12, 2020, in a news release to be posted on our website at duke-energy.com/investors. An earnings conference call for analysts will be scheduled that day to discuss first quarter 2020 financial results and other business and financial updates, including an update on the actual and estimated potential business and financial effects of the COVID-19 pandemic.
